nutcracker binary package in Ubuntu Lunar arm64
nutcracker, also known as twemproxy (pronounced "two-em-proxy"), is a
fast and lightweight proxy for the memcached and Redis protocols. It was
primarily built to reduce the connection count on backend caching
servers, but it has a number of features, such as:
* Maintains persistent server connections to backend servers.
* Enables pipelining of requests and responses.
* Supports multiple server pools simultaneously.
* Shard data automatically across multiple servers.
* Supports multiple hashing modes including consistent hashing and
distribution.
* High-availability by disabling nodes on failures.
* Observability through stats exposed on stats monitoring port.
